the Section Sanitaire Anglaise, which was made up of British volunteers, typically ambulance drivers, attached to the French and or Belgian Armies.
This particular British volunteer unit SSA 14, photographed in 1916, was based in the Northern French costal town of Dunkerque just 6 miles from the Belgian border, and consisted mainly of Quakers from the Friends Ambulance Unit ( FAU ) who were usually also Conscientious Objectors.
